Presently, the only national radio station to use continuity announcers is BBC Radio 4, where many of the announcing staff also act as newsreaders and also introduce the station's Shipping Forecast. Helen Veysey In the United Kingdom, continuity announcers are people who are employed to introduce programmes on radio and television networks, to promote forthcoming programmes on the station, to cross-promote programmes on the broadcaster's other stations where applicable and, sometimes, to provide information relating to the programme just broadcast. www.sophieneville.co.uk/BEENIE/daphne.html. It's about time someone shone a spotlight on the trusty band of announcers who glue together Radio 4's output with pre-recorded trails, scripted bits, and cheerful ad-libbing in the 50 or so continuity slots each day.
